Just For Fun: Santa Claus Elected To North Pole City Council
It's true. A man who's legal name is Santa Claus recently won a write-in campaign for North Pole, Alaska City Council.
In a few months, eager and giddy children around Pennsylvania will begin penning their wish lists for none other than Santa Claus.
But will Santa Claus be too tied up with his municipal government responsibilities to pull off a successful Christmas?
It’s true: a man who legal name is Santa Claus recently won a write-in campaign for North Pole, Alaska City Council.

The election was last week and results were announced on Tuesday, ABC News reported.
Claus, the former president of the North Pole Chamber of Commerce, told the news network in an interview that he is looking forward to serving the “great community.”

Claus is a cancer patient and child advocate who uses medical marijuana and supports opening medical marijuana dispensaries in North Pole, ABC News said.
According to his Facebook profile, which is public, Claus is the only man legally named Santa Claus to ever to live in North Pole, Alaska.
